怎样通过ant脚本获取某个路径下面的文件名!!
求大神快快现身,比如获取strPath路径下的aaaa.cpp文件,
该怎么写呢:?急求!!谢谢了!

解决方案 »

  1.   

    <project name="ProjectName" default="deploy" basedir=".">
        <target name="deploy">
           <fileset dir="${basedir}\strPath">
        <include name="aaaa.cpp"/>
           </fileset>
        </targe>
    </project>basedir=".",表示当前项目的根目录。
      

  2.   

    可能我说的不太明确,
    就是我填写的路径,subsystem\nemgr_access\server\src\profilesyspara\bmsprofilesyspara.vcproj,只能截取到前面
    subsystem\nemgr_access\server\src\profilesyspara\这一部分,后面取不到,我想问下怎么才能取到整个路径,然后传给一个变量呢?
        <target name="compile" depends="init_compile_env">        <propertycopy property="proj_name" from="patches.${PATCH_NUM}.compile.${PROJ_NAME}(prj)" />         <property name="full_path" value="${COMPILE_DIR}/${proj_name}"/>          <echo>         ......Begin compile project:${full_path}        </echo>